Transaction 592617d7075d47b6cb351a50df110caf37aacd193fdbfa8a9fc4da63feaf1fec

7 Input
2 Outputs
  • 592617d7075d47b6cb351a50df110caf37aacd193fdbfa8a9fc4da63feaf1fec:0
  • value  3187126
    address  1A91Jy187FieqvMidfNe8PxkFNGMndWFot
  • 592617d7075d47b6cb351a50df110caf37aacd193fdbfa8a9fc4da63feaf1fec:1
  • value  46343820
    address  3H5o3xw1NmeCeDPZuktb9cP2JD7FotxQku